Overview

Ira Mellman is affiliated with Genentech in the United States and has an extensive publication record in the fields of medicine, immunology, and microbiology. Their scientific contributions primarily focus on the intersection of cancer immunotherapy, immune cell function, and molecular biology.

The research topics covered by Ira Mellman include:

  • Cancer Immunotherapy and Biomarkers
  • Immune Cell Function and Interaction
  • CAR-T cell therapy research
  • Immunotherapy and Immune Responses
  • Immune cells in cancer
  • Cancer Genomics and Diagnostics
  • T-cell and B-cell Immunology

Their work spans several subfields such as immunology, oncology, molecular biology, cancer research, and surgery, with a significant number of publications under medicine and immunology as the main fields.

Notable recent publications by Ira Mellman include:

  • "Personalized RNA neoantigen vaccines stimulate T cells in pancreatic cancer," 2023, published in Nature
  • "Peripheral T cell expansion predicts tumour infiltration and clinical response," 2020, published in Nature
  • "The cancer-immunity cycle: Indication, genotype, and immunotype," 2023, published in Immunity
  • "IL-1 and IL-1ra are key regulators of the inflammatory response to RNA vaccines," 2022, published in Nature Immunology
  • "PD-L1 expression by dendritic cells is a key regulator of T-cell immunity in cancer," 2020, published in Nature Cancer

Ira Mellman has been recognized with membership in the National Academy of Sciences since 2011 and was named a Fellow of the American Academy of Arts and Sciences in 2001.
